      Meaning of the first name Kelden

      Origin

      English, Primarily in the U.s

      Meaning

      Often Associated With from the Spring

      Variations

      Belden, Kellen, Keldon
      The name Kelden is of English origin, predominantly found in the United States. It is often interpreted as meaning from the spring, which evokes imagery of renewal and vitality associated with water sources. This name can symbolize freshness and growth, linking the individual to natural elements and cyclic patterns of life.

      While Kelden may not have an extensive historical prominence, it represents a blending of traditional English naming conventions with contemporary influences. Names related to natural features have been common throughout history, and Kelden fits this pattern, emerging as a modern adaptation that captures the essence of nature in a unique way. Its emergence in English-speaking regions can be traced to the desire for distinctive names that hold personal or symbolic significance.

      In contemporary settings, Kelden appears as a relatively uncommon but appealing name choice for parents seeking something unique yet grounded in tradition. It conveys a sense of individuality while retaining a connection to its English roots. As naming trends evolve, Kelden stands out among names that evoke nature, becoming a choice for those interested in names with meaningful connotations in today's society.
